阿里云 Windows Server 实例默认不开启图形界面(即不安装桌面体验/桌面环境),具体取决于所选的镜像版本和配置:
✅ 标准行为(推荐/常见情况):
- 阿里云官方提供的 Windows Server(如 2019、2022)Datacenter 或 Standard 版本的“Server Core”或“Minimal Server Interface”镜像(尤其是默认推荐镜像)通常以 Server Core 模式或无 GUI 模式部署**。
- 这类实例默认没有图形用户界面(GUI),仅提供命令行环境(PowerShell / CMD),通过 RDP 连接时会提示“无法连接到远程计算机”或黑屏/报错(因缺少桌面会话管理器)。
⚠️ 注意区分:
| 镜像类型 | 是否含 GUI | 说明 |
|———-|————|——|
| ✅ Windows Server with Desktop Experience(如 win2019_64_dtc_2023xx 中明确含 dtc 或 DesktopExperience) | ✔️ 是 | 默认启用完整图形界面,支持 RDP 正常登录桌面。阿里云控制台部分镜像名称会标注 “带桌面体验” 或含 dtc(Datacenter with Desktop Experience)。 |
| ⚠️ Windows Server (Core) 或未标注 dtc 的镜像(如 win2022_64_core_2023xx) | ❌ 否 | 仅 Server Core,无 GUI,RDP 默认不可用(需手动安装桌面体验或改用 PowerShell Remoting)。 |
🔍 如何确认?
- 查看镜像名称:在阿里云 ECS 控制台创建实例时,鼠标悬停或点击镜像详情,检查是否包含
Desktop Experience、dtc或带桌面字样。 - 登录后验证:
# 在已连上的 PowerShell(如通过SSM或串口)中执行: Get-WindowsFeature | Where-Object {$_.Name -eq "Server-Gui-Shell"} | Select-Object Installed # 若返回 False,则 GUI 未安装
🔧 补充说明:
- 即使是带桌面的镜像,RDP 服务(Remote Desktop Services)默认是启用的,但需确保安全组放行 TCP 3389 端口,且实例已设置强密码的管理员账户。
- 阿里云建议生产环境优先使用 Server Core 模式(更轻量、更安全、更少补丁),GUI 仅在必要时(如运行需图形化操作的软件)才启用。
✅ 结论:
阿里云 Windows Server 实例默认是否开启图形界面,取决于所选镜像——绝大多数默认推荐镜像是无 GUI 的 Server Core 模式;若需图形界面,请务必选择明确标注 “Desktop Experience” 或 “带桌面”的镜像。
如需为已创建的 Core 实例添加桌面界面,可通过 PowerShell 安装(需重启):
Install-WindowsFeature Server-Gui-Mgmt-Infra, Server-Gui-Shell -Restart
需要我帮你判断某具体镜像 ID 是否含 GUI,或指导安装桌面体验,欢迎提供镜像名称 😊
PHPWP博客